Michael Kors Watch Troubleshooting: A Step-by-Step Approach

Before resorting to drastic measures or contacting support, let's systematically troubleshoot your Michael Kors watch. This methodical approach will often pinpoint the problem and allow for a quick resolution.

1. Battery Life and Charging:

* Low Battery: The most common reason for a malfunctioning smartwatch is a depleted battery. Ensure your watch is properly connected to its charging cradle and charging. Allow sufficient time for charging – often several hours for a full charge. Observe the charging indicator (usually a light on the watch or cradle) to confirm charging is in progress. A faulty charging cable or cradle can also be the culprit. Try a different cable or cradle if possible.

* Charging Issues: If your watch isn't charging, inspect the charging contacts on both the watch and the cradle for any debris, dirt, or corrosion. Gently clean these contacts with a soft, dry cloth. A slightly damp cloth may be used, but ensure it's completely dry before reconnecting.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ials. If the problem persists, the charging cradle itself might be faulty.

2. Software Glitches and Factory Reset:

* Software Bugs: Sometimes, software glitches can cause unexpected behavior. A simple restart might resolve the issue. The method for restarting your Michael Kors watch will depend on the specific model. Consult your watch's user manual for instructions. If a restart doesn't work, a factory reset might be necessary.

* Factory Reset: A factory reset will erase all data on your watch and restore it to its original factory settings. This is a powerful troubleshooting step that can resolve many software problems. However, remember to back up any important data beforehand if possible. The steps for performing a factory reset vary depending on the watch model. Refer to the official Michael Kors support website (link provided below) for detailed instructions specific to your watch. The website often contains helpful videos and FAQs. This is a crucial step, and often overlooked. A quick search for "[Your Michael Kors Watch Model] Factory Reset" on YouTube can also yield helpful videos.

3. Connectivity Problems:

* Bluetooth Connection: If your Michael Kors watch is connected to your smartphone, ensure the Bluetooth connection is stable and active. On your phone, check the Bluetooth settings and make sure your watch is paired correctly. Try disconnecting and re-pairing the watch. Restarting both your phone and your watch can also resolve connectivity issues. If you're using a different device, ensure it’s compatible with your Michael Kors watch.

* Wi-Fi Connection (if applicable): Some Michael Kors watches have Wi-Fi capabilities. If your watch uses Wi-Fi, ensure it's connected to a stable network. Check the Wi-Fi settings on your watch and verify the password and network name are correct. Restarting your router might also help.
